Holger Rune Faces Flavio Cobolli in Madrid ATP Showdown

Madrid, Spain – Holger Rune of Denmark will take on Italy’s Flavio Cobolli in a highly anticipated matchup at the ATP Madrid Open on Friday, April 25, 2025, scheduled to begin at 2:10 PM ET. Rune, ranked ninth in the world, seeks to advance to the third round after a strong start to the season, including a title win in Barcelona.
Rune, 21, has shown impressive form this year, notably reaching the finals at the Miami Open, while illness hindered his performance at Monte Carlo. Meanwhile, Cobolli, 22, who is currently ranked just inside the top 40, is looking to make a statement after a title win in Bucharest.
The match marks the second encounter between the two players, with Rune narrowly winning their previous clash at the 2024 French Open. Rune edged out Cobolli in a five-set battle that showcased both players’ resilience and skill. Rune’s solid form has made him the favorite going into Friday’s match, with predictions giving him a 62% chance of winning.
Greg Butyn, a data analyst for Dimers, noted, “After simulating the match 10,000 times, Rune is favored to win with a 62% probability.” Cobolli’s chances are estimated at 38%, making it a pivotal match for both players.
Fans can watch the match live on Sky Sports Tennis in the UK and Tennis Channel in the US, with online streaming available via Sky Go and Tennis Channel’s website. The match will be played on outdoor clay at Park Manzanares, a surface where both players have displayed great potential.
